- The distance between Jos, Nigeria and Shenyang, China is approximately 11,240 km or 6,984 mi.
- To reach Jos in this distance one would set out from Shenyang bearing 294.1°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Jos bearing 223.7° or SW .
- Jos has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Shenyang has a hot summer continental climate with dry winters (Dwa).
- Jos is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Shenyang is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average temperature is 13.7 °C (24.6°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 31.8 °C (57.2°F) less in Jos.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 630.4 mm (24.8 in) more which is equivalent to 630.4 l/m² (15.47 US gal/ft²) or 6,304,000 l/ha (673,939 US gal/ac) more. About 2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 25.3° higher in Jos than in Shenyang.
